The import and export price indexes (MXP) calculate the deviations in the prices of goods and services coming in and out of the United States. The indexes are published once a month and are created by the Bureau of Labor Statistics’ (BLS) International Price Program (IPP).
How Import and Export Price Indexes (MXP) Work?
The import and export price indexes (MXP) are made by mixing the values of goods bought in the U.S. but produced outside of the country (imports) and vice-versa.
The way the BLS defines its indexes is “comprising data on deviation in the prices of non-military goods and services traded between the U.S. and the world.” They measure, it adds: “how values of a market basket of commodities and services in international business keep fluctuating from one phase to the next.”
However, U.S Dollars is not the currency for all the trade that takes place there. According to a recent report published by the B.L.S, 6% of the total import and export trade that takes place in terms of merchandise and commodities are not produced in the United States, at all. The technique is to convert the prices into the locally used currency and employing an average price of it for the goods. This conversion is done one month before the actual pricing. The price deviations for the months before that are published during the middle of the month that comes after.
What are the Advantages of the Import and Export Indexes(MXP)?
The Import and Export Indexes can be vital for several reasons. below listed are some of the purposes they can be used for:
- It helps in negotiating during making contracts and agreements for business and Trade.
- It is the best instrument to detect and guess what future inflations can take place and what the market prices of things would be.
- In identifying the trends in the general market of the world and the way the different companies are performing on a universal level. The overall growth of a country can thus be guessed from it.
- To evaluate the rate of exchange of goods between different countries and the profit margin in the process can be assessed using the Indexes.
- The statistics used by the government can be identified and deflated when one is aware of the trade import and export indexes.
- The Federal Reserve Body is responsible for making policies and Laws for the growth of the indexes. the present indexes help them in understanding what rules and regulations and policies to make and implement.

9. Import and Export Price Index Currency Choice
To understand import and export types and techniques read this paper on the role of nominal rigidities and currency choice. Using both regressions- and VAR-based estimates, the paper finds that the exchange rate pass-through to import prices for a large number of countries is incomplete and larger than the pass-through to export prices. 11. Quarterly Export and Import Price Indices
To measure the overall price changes (in Mauritian rupees) of domestically produced goods exported to other countries, the instrument of EPI(Export Price Index) is used. Import Price Index is just the opposite of that and it calculates the deviation in prices (in Mauritian rupees) of commodities purchased from other countries (excluding Freeport activities).
